21xrx.com
2024-11-22 07:13:00 Friday
登录
文章检索 我的文章 写文章
在开发Java程序时
2023-06-11 00:49:51 深夜i     --     --
Java 按钮 大小

在开发Java程序时,经常需要使用按钮控件来实现用户的交互。但是,在实际编程过程中,我们会发现默认的按钮大小可能不太满足我们的需求,需要进行自定义设置。那么,如何在Java中设置按钮的大小呢?

首先,我们可以通过使用setLayout()方法来设置布局方式,从而实现按钮的大小调整。具体地,我们可以使用FlowLayout布局、GridLayout布局或者BoxLayout布局等方式来实现。例如,如果我们使用FlowLayout布局,那么设置组件的大小可以通过设置FlowLayout的hgap属性和vgap属性来实现。

另外,我们还可以通过使用setPreferredSize()方法来设置按钮的大小。该方法可以接收一个Dimension对象作为参数,用于表示组件的“首选尺寸”,即组件在使用布局管理器进行布局时的大小。具体来说,我们可以通过创建一个Dimension对象,并通过设置宽度和高度来实现按钮的大小调整。

最后,如果使用Swing等高级GUI库,我们还可以通过设置UI属性来实现按钮的自定义大小。具体来说,我们可以通过继承javax.swing.plaf.basic.BasicButtonUI类并重写getPreferredSize()方法来实现。在该方法中,我们可以返回一个新的Dimension对象来指定按钮的大小。

总之,Java中的按钮设计非常灵活多样,可以根据实际情况选择不同的方式进行自定义设置。通过上述方法,我们可以轻松实现按钮的大小调整,为用户的更好体验提供保障。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复